Will PAL games on an NTSC console/TV set show up distorted?
I know U.S. NTSC console games played on European PAL consoles will show up black and white.
Is the same true the other way around? Is there a cheap way to make say PAL PS2 games work on a US PS2?

i've played PAL psx games on a chipped NTSC psx + NTSC TV; it is fucked up.
you have rip an image of the game, patch the image, burn it, and play the "fixed" burn in order to get the vertical hold and colors to be ok.
it will be fucked up if you just stick a PAL game in an NTSC console on an NTSC TV.
the other way to fix it is the way we did: we hooked the psx to an old commadore monitor we had laying around using the RGB inputs.
